Event Staff, Community Aide (NCS) - Baltimore City Recreation and Parks
Position Summary: City of Baltimore is seeking multiple Community Aide/Event Staff members to support the Horticulture Division with logistical management of private events such as weddings, conferences, and galas. Selected candidates will be part of a roster of event staff notified when work is available and may work up to 25 hours per week, including evenings and weekends.
Salary: $15.00–$30.00 per hour.
Starting Pay: $16.00 per hour.
- Prepare venue by setting up before and breaking down equipment after events; provide audio‑visual equipment support as needed.
- Provide excellent customer service to guests.
- Ensure all COVID‑19 protocols are followed.
- Direct parking for larger events.
- Perform light custodial duties during events.
- Work under the instruction of the event manager.
- Other duties as assigned.
- Education: High‑school graduate or GED certificate.
- Age: Must be 18 years of age or older.
- License: Valid Maryland Class C non‑commercial driver’s license or equivalent; must be able to obtain a Baltimore City driver’s permit. Provisional driver’s licenses are not acceptable.
